Pâté de Champignons
Pâté de Champignons is a delightful vegan spread that captures the essence of French cuisine with its rich, earthy flavors. Made with fresh mushrooms, aromatic herbs, and a touch of garlic, it is perfect for spreading on crusty bread or serving with crackers.

30 minutes
Difficulty: Medium
French
210 kcal
Ingredients
- Mushrooms (cremini or button) - 200 grams, finely chopped
- Olive oil - 2 tablespoons
- Shallot - 1, finely chopped
- Garlic - 2 cloves, minced
- Fresh thyme - 1 teaspoon, chopped
- Fresh parsley - 2 tablespoons, chopped
- Soy sauce - 1 tablespoon
- Nutritional yeast - 2 tablespoons
- Lemon juice - 1 tablespoon
- Salt - 1/2 teaspoon
- Black pepper - 1/4 teaspoon
- Walnuts - 50 grams, finely chopped
Steps
- Heat olive oil in a skillet over medium heat. Add the chopped shallot and sauté for about 3 minutes until translucent.
- Add the minced garlic and cook for an additional 1 minute, being careful not to burn it.
- Stir in the chopped mushrooms and cook for about 10 minutes, until they release their moisture and become tender.
- Add the chopped thyme, soy sauce, nutritional yeast, lemon juice, salt, and pepper. Cook for another 5 minutes, stirring occasionally.
- Remove the skillet from heat and let the mixture cool slightly.
- Transfer the mixture to a food processor, add the chopped walnuts, and blend until smooth, scraping down the sides as necessary.
- Taste and adjust seasoning if needed. Transfer the pâté to a serving bowl and refrigerate for at least 1 hour to allow the flavors to meld.
- Serve chilled or at room temperature with bread or crackers.
Nutrition
- Calories: 210
- Protein: 6 g
- Carbs: 10 g
- Fiber: 3 g
- Sugar: 1 g
- Sodium: 300 mg
- Cholesterol: 0 mg
- Total Fat: 18 g
- Saturated Fat: 2 g
- Unsaturated Fat: 16 g
- Water: 0.2 L
